Universal Genève — 1940 Spider-Lug Watch
This Universal Genève from 1940 presents a distinctive spider-lug case profile that speaks to the refined dress-watch aesthetics of its era. The sculpted lugs and understated presence reflect thoughtful mid-century case design and hand-finished detailing. At its heart sits the Cal. 263, a period movement representative of Universal Genève’s technical competence and practical reliability. For the contemporary collector, the watch offers a direct link to 1940s watchmaking: an opportunity to appreciate classical proportions, historical movement engineering, and the tactile pleasures of a well-crafted vintage wristwatch.
